A new contender has emerged in gaming accessories with the $30 Deluxe RDS case for the Switch 2. After an announcement sparked discussion on forums, users express excitement over its features and pricing disparity compared to a smaller alternative.

Product Context and Pricing Disparity

The Deluxe RDS case, priced at $30, promises ample space for the Switch 2, unlike a smaller model that retails for $20 but lacks enough room for a dock or controller. This difference in design and pricing has ignited conversations among gamers eager to protect their devices.
